To me, the problem is over harvest of baitfish (menhaden, herring, mackeral, whiting, etc.) that is the problem, not the under harvest of bass. We've completely screwed up to ocean ecosystem and that is going to have consequences and everyone sees those consequences from their own point of vier. Lobsterman see too many bass eating lobsters. Striperman see bass that aren't as big/fat as they used to be. And on and on. Almost every bass that I've kept over the past few years has had nothing but crabs or lobster in their stomachs, most have nothing at all.
and the numbers of seals on the cape that eat all the bait are a good part of the problem of not having enough bait for bass and blues. I have not caught a fat bass ever in the last decade.
